Quick Answer
The answer is SXP and CDP. SGT propagation methods for non-inline devices rely on these two protocols because devices that cannot insert Security Group Tags directly into the packet header—such as older switches or firewalls—need an out-of-band mechanism to share SGT-to-IP bindings. SXP (SGT Exchange Protocol) is the primary method, acting as a TCP-based transport that maps IP addresses to SGTs between Cisco TrustSec domains, while CDP (Cisco Discovery Protocol) can carry SGT information in certain implementations, though it is less common and more limited in scope. On the Cisco SCOR / CCNP Security Core 350-701 exam, this tests your understanding of TrustSec architecture and the distinction between inline tagging (e.g., 802.1Q or MACsec) and propagation protocols for non-inline devices. A common trap is confusing LLDP with CDP—LLDP does not support SGT propagation, so always remember that only Cisco-proprietary CDP has this capability.
